> > --- Comment #4 from Aaron Dominick (aaron.zakhrov@gmail.com) ---
> > (In reply to Eric Sandeen from comment #2)
> > > Why do you feel this is an xfs bug?  I don't see any indication of xfs
> > > problems in your logs.
> > 
> > I dont think the logs are being captured. Basically after I boot and enter
> my
> > lvm password, the system locks up with a bunch of pending in flight
> requests.
> > Among them are the xfs_buf_ioend_work
> 
> Your kernel oopsed trying to load firmware for the iwl driver.
> Everything after that is colateral damage. Sort out the firmware
> loading problem first because once that problem goes away all the
> others should, too.
> 
> Cheers,
> 
> Dave.

OK my bad. 5.10-rc2 seems to work fine
